Rewiring Reason to Logic Express or Logic Pro

Rewiring Reason to Logic lets you use both applications together. First launch Logic, then launch Reason (very important - if you launch Reason first this will not work!). You’ll know it’s set up correctly when the hardware interface displays Rewire Slave Mode.


At this point, Reason’s audio is routed to Logic, but you must create an aux track in Logic to capture the audio. In Logic’s mixer, click the + button to add an aux track and set the assignments to stereo, and input from Reason Mix L-R.

 






To send MIDI data to Reason from Logic, create an external MIDI track for each device in Reason. Click the + button in the arrange window.

Assign the external MIDI track to your Reason device in the library.
